How to Track Payments and Reduce Overdue Invoices
Late payments often come from weak process, not only from difficult clients. If invoice status, payment records, and reminders are unclear, overdue balances grow quickly.
What helps most
A strong workflow should let you:
- see the status of every invoice
- record payments immediately
- track partial payments correctly
- send reminders on schedule
- review outstanding balances at a glance
Practical strategy
Start with a clear due date.
Send the invoice promptly.
Make payment instructions visible.
Use reminders before and after the due date.
Review overdue reports weekly, not randomly.
